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Manufacturing Machine Operators in Clarke, Georgia play a crucial role in the production process, ensuring machines are running efficiently and producing high-quality products. - Entry-level Machine Operator salaries range from $25,000 to $30,000 per year - Mid-career Production Operator salaries range from $30,000 to $40,000 per year - Senior-level Manufacturing Technician salaries range from $40,000 to $50,000 per year The role of a Manufacturing Machine Operator in Clarke, Georgia has a long history rooted in the industrial revolution and the rise of manufacturing industries in the region. As technology advanced, the role evolved to include more automation and specialized skills. In recent years, the role of a Manufacturing Machine Operator in Clarke, Georgia has continued to evolve with advancements in technology. Operators now work with complex machinery and computer systems to ensure efficient production processes. Additionally, there is a growing emphasis on sustainability and environmental practices in manufacturing operations. Current trends in the manufacturing industry in Clarke, Georgia include the integration of Internet of Things (IoT) technology to improve efficiency, the implementation of lean manufacturing principles to reduce waste, and a focus on continuous training and upskilling for operators to keep up with technological advancements.
